Efrina is a delicate, elegant, and flowing handwritten font that stands out for its meticulously crafted characters. Its well-balanced letterforms create a harmonious rhythm, making it a versatile asset across a wide pool of design applications. As a PUA encoded font, it provides immediate access to a full suite of glyphs and swashes, empowering designers to customize their typography with ease. Features like a varying baseline, smooth lines, and stunning alternates allow for unique, organic compositions that feel both personal and professional.

Integrating a Font into Your Design Workflow
Selecting a new creative asset like a font should be a strategic decision. To evaluate Efrina or any similar typeface effectively, consider these factors:
- Consistency and Readability: Test it across different sizes and backgrounds. A beautiful script must remain legible, especially in smaller digital applications or on busy packaging.
- Scalability: Ensure the font’s details are preserved when scaled up for large-format prints or down for mobile UI elements.
- Visual Hierarchy: Use it to establish clear hierarchy. Its decorative nature typically suits headlines and accents rather than long paragraphs, ensuring optimal user experience (UX).
- Brand Alignment: Does its personality match your brand’s voice? A flowing script like Efrina conveys creativity, warmth, and elegance, which should align with your overall visual design strategy.
When incorporating such a font, think about its interaction with your color palette and imagery. It often pairs best with simple, clean sans-serif fonts for body text to maintain balance and readability.
